Klaros-Testmanagement logo Klaros-Testmanagement

Klaros-Testmanagement is a professional web based test management tool.

RainforestQA logo RainforestQA

Insanely simple testing. Create tests for your website in plain English, then run them across all major browsers with a single click. Powered by human intelligence
